12 years in, over £30,000 raised for local and international causes and Fieldview has booked another year full of good vibes and energy.

Starting with the music, the Friday and Saturday headliners are Jenna And The G’s and The Mouse Outfit respectively.

The Mouse Outfit have a new album dropping on the 4th May, and have been working with album features from IAMDBB, Dr Syntax and Sparkz. They were on the main stages back in 2015, and they bought an entourage of people who bought something special to the Club Tropicana vibes. This year we’re expecting more of the same.

You might know Jenna G from her appearances with DJ giants Chase & Status, DJ Marky or DJ Zinc to name a few. Well, now there’s a full band to support her and her incredible voice. They’ll be bringing soul, funk and a whole lot more to get your move on to.

Supporting headliners for the Friday and Saturday are Jono McCleery and Afrikan Boy.

Jono McCleery has been setting the bar for Acoustic, Nu-Jazz and Folk for over 10 years now. He is one of the best songwriters and lyricists around, and his latest album is proof of this.

Afrikan Boy brings some more energy leading up to The Mouse Outfit. He’s part grime, part afrobeat, and all vibes. If you haven’t heard of him, and don’t know what to expect, then some of the people he’s worked with will put you in the picture - DJ Shadow, DJ Yoda and M.I.A.
